What Qualifies as Mild Scoliosis?

Scoliosis is classified based on the Cobb angle; a measurement used to determine the degree of spinal curvature. Mild scoliosis is typically defined as a curve measuring between 10 and 25 degrees.
Though less obvious and often less symptomatic than moderate or severe curves, mild scoliosis should not be ignored. Even at this early stage, a curve can affect:

  • Posture and spinal alignment
  • Flexibility and range of motion
  • Muscle balance

It is not uncommon to see pain and stiffness present in people with mild curvatures.

Over time, a mild curve has the potential to worsen, especially during growth spurts in children and adolescents. That’s why early awareness and proactive care are essential.

Breaking Down the Medical Terminology

Doctors often use detailed, but sometimes confusing, terminology when diagnosing scoliosis. For example, mild thoracic dextroscoliosis can sound intimidating, but here’s what it really means:

  • Mild – The curve measures between 10–25 degrees
  • Thoracic – Located in the upper/mid-back region of the spine
  • Dextroscoliosis – The curve bends to the right side

So, “mild thoracic dextroscoliosis” simply refers to a small spinal curve in the upper back, bending to the right. While this may seem minor, such curves can still lead to muscle imbalance, asymmetry, or visible changes in posture over time if left unaddressed.

Understanding the Cobb Angle

The Cobb angle is the standard method used to measure and track scoliosis progression. It is often the first objective sign that scoliosis is present, and it plays a key role in monitoring changes.

Scoliosis classification by Cobb angle:

  • Mild: 10–24 degrees
  • Moderate: 25–39 degrees
  • Severe: Over 40 degrees

How the Cobb Angle Is Measured:

  • A posterior-anterior (PA) spinal X-ray is taken (viewed from back to front).
  • A line is drawn across the top of the uppermost tilted vertebra above the curve apex. 
  • Another line is drawn across the bottom of the lowest tilted vertebra beneath the apex.
  • Perpendicular lines are then drawn from each line.
  • The angle where these lines intersect is the Cobb angle.

Note: A curve that increases by 5 degrees or more is typically considered to be progressing and should be monitored closely.

Why Early Management Matters

Even when a curve is classified as mild, it can progress quickly, especially during adolescence. Growth spurts, muscle weakness, poor posture, or underlying conditions can all contribute to worsening curvature. That’s why early intervention is key.

Treatment Options for Mild Scoliosis

The good news is that most mild cases respond very well to non-surgical, exercise-based treatment.

At Scoliosis SOS, we use the ScolioGold Method, a combination of therapies tailored to each patient’s condition and goals, including:

  • Schroth-based scoliosis-specific physiotherapy
  • Core strengthening and postural retraining
  • Lifestyle adjustments and ergonomic advice
  • Ongoing monitoring with repeat measurements

In some adolescent cases where the curve shows signs of progression, bracing may be introduced alongside therapy to reduce the chance of surgery in the future.

This comparative X-ray image, provided by the European Training Foundation for Chiropractic (ETFC), shows the progressive nature of idiopathic scoliosis across three common classifications:

Mild Scoliosis (10–24 degrees)

  • Often subtle and hard to spot without imaging
  • May present as uneven shoulders, slight waist asymmetry, or a tilted pelvis
  • Usually not painful, but can cause postural changes and muscle imbalances
  • Best managed early with observation, targeted exercises, or physiotherapy

Moderate Scoliosis (25–40 degrees)

  • The curve becomes more visible, especially in posture and shoulder alignment
  • May cause muscle fatigue, back stiffness, and limited spinal flexibility
  • At this stage, there’s a higher risk of continued progression—especially in adolescents
  • Treatment may include bracing alongside exercise-based therapy

Severe Scoliosis (Over 40 degrees)

  • The curve can begin to impact lung function and cause noticeable asymmetries
  • Often associated with chronic pain or reduced mobility in adulthood
  • In some cases, surgical correction may be considered.

      Scoliosis progression varies from person to person. A mild curve can remain stable, or progress significantly, depending on factors like age, growth, posture, and early intervention.
